Description

Pd(Ipr)(Acac)Cl is a highly specialized organometallic complex featuring a palladium center coordinated by a bulky N-heterocyclic carbene (Ipr) ligand, an acetylacetonate (acac) ligand, and a chloride. This compound matters as a sophisticated, well-defined catalyst precursor, offering superior stability and tunable reactivity for demanding cross-coupling and C-H activation reactions. It is primarily needed by research chemists and process development scientists in the pharmaceutical, agrochemical, and advanced materials industries for developing novel synthetic pathways.

Application

  • Precursor for highly active and selective palladium catalysts in cross-coupling reactions (e.g., Suzuki-Miyaura, Buchwald-Hartwig, Negishi).
  • Catalyst for challenging C-H bond functionalization and activation processes in organic synthesis.
  • Key reagent in the research and development of new pharmaceutical intermediates and active ingredients.
  • Use in the synthesis of specialty chemicals and complex organic molecules for agrochemicals.
  • Catalyst component for polymerization reactions and materials science applications.
  • Tool compound for mechanistic studies in organometallic chemistry and catalysis.

Storage

Preserve in a tightly closed container, protected from light. Store under an inert atmosphere (e.g., nitrogen or argon) at 2-8°C to minimize oxidation and degradation. This material is hygroscopic and must be kept in a dry environment. Allow the sealed container to equilibrate to room temperature before opening to prevent moisture condensation.
